Recently acquired a used 2000 Kawasaki Lakota 300. I bought it as-is, and it is missing the transmission cover and everything outside of it, and the air filter and cover. Trying to determine if it is worth fixing, would love to find a blown motor for cheap I could rob the parts of off. Any thoughts?

Transmission cover is on ebay along with some other parts. Just depends on what all's missing. Put a pencil to the cost you have in it and what you think it may cost to get it up and running. May or may not have more into it than what it's worth on something like this.Lakota 300 engine parts | eBay
